Understanding the Mechanics of Full-Time 4WD Drivetrain

The full-time four-wheel-drive (4WD) drivetrain in Toyota Land Cruisers is engineered for optimal performance across diverse terrains. This system operates continuously, providing power to all four wheels without requiring driver intervention. The core mechanics involve several key components that work in unison to enhance traction and stability.

At the heart of the 4WD drivetrain is the transfer case, which splits the engine’s torque between the front and rear axles. Unlike part-time systems, the full-time variant utilizes a center differential, allowing for differences in wheel speed between the front and rear axles. This feature is particularly beneficial during cornering, as it prevents tire slippage and traction loss.

The front and rear differentials further enhance the drivetrain’s functionality. These components allow each wheel to rotate at different speeds, essential for maintaining control during turns. The limited-slip differential option can also provide additional traction, distributing power to the wheels with the most grip.

Moreover, the full-time 4WD drivetrain is often paired with advanced electronic systems that monitor wheel slip and adjust power distribution proactively. This integration improves stability on slippery surfaces, such as mud, snow, or gravel. Drivers can rely on the drivetrain’s capability to navigate challenging conditions with confidence.

Maintenance Tips for Long-Term Performance of 4WD Systems

Maintenance Tips for Long-Term Performance of 4WD Systems

To ensure the longevity and optimal performance of the 4WD systems in Toyota Land Cruisers, regular maintenance is essential. First and foremost, routine fluid changes play a crucial role in keeping the drivetrain components lubricated and functioning smoothly. Engine oil, transmission fluid, and transfer case oil should be checked and replaced according to the manufacturer’s recommendations.

Another critical aspect of maintenance involves inspecting and replacing worn or damaged drivetrain components. This includes checking the condition of driveshafts, u-joints, and differentials. Any signs of wear can lead to significant issues if left unaddressed, potentially leading to costly repairs.

Tire care is equally important for maintaining 4WD performance. Regular rotation and alignment help ensure even tire wear, which can significantly affect traction and handling. Always keep tires properly inflated according to specifications, as this can impact overall drivetrain efficiency.

Additionally, pay attention to the 4WD system itself. Engaging and disengaging 4WD on a regular basis helps to keep the components lubricated and prevents potential seizing. Ensure that the vacuum lines and electrical connections related to the 4WD engagement system are intact and functioning properly.

Lastly, consider a thorough inspection of the suspension system. Since it affects how power is transmitted through the drivetrain, worn suspension parts can lead to complications in 4WD operation. Regular checks can help identify and rectify issues before they escalate.
